Phone number ☎️ 01253314376 👆 is reported as a scam call pretending to be from a bank security team, using a robotic voice to warn about fake suspicious card transactions. Callers try to trick people into pressing buttons to cancel or talk to "security," but it's a ploy. Many say its very obvious and should be ignored.

About 01 Numbers
These numbers correspond to spec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by residential and commercial properties. Frequently termed as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that offer free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are based on the chosen calling plan, with various pl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
